Munch and the sea

An exclusive exhibit at Tacoma Art Museum explores the sea as motif in Munch’s art Linn Chloe Hagstrøm Norwegian American Weekly Many art pieces by renowned Norwegian artist and master printmaker Edvard Munch have arrived in Tacoma, Wash. Visit Tacoma Art Museum (TAM) and travel from Puget Sound to the fjords of Norway through the new exhibit Edvard Munch and the Sea, which offers a focused exploration of the sea as a recurring motif in Munch’s life and art.
